Buzz Stick Black Mambas with 3-2 Loss
|
Fans saw a dandy of a game between the Salt Lake City Buzz and Austin Black Mambas.
Austin wasted an exceptional performance by pitcher Jason O'Rourke, falling to the Salt Lake City Buzz, 3-2. O'Rourke threw 7.1 innings of 5-hit ball for the losing team. Shinsui Kawaguchi closed the game out for Salt Lake City, earning his 7th save.
Nherbert Imperial was a prime contributor to the Salt Lake City win. He was 2 for 4 with 2 singles, while adding 2 RBI. In the top of the sixth with one out, the 30-year old catcher hit a run-scoring single. It made the score 3-1, in favor of the Buzz.
"It was a good effort all around," said Imperial.
Salt Lake City is 9th in the Menard's AAA with a record of 44-58.
